Overview
Pitt Digital offers a powerful Enterprise Digital Signage solution, powered by Poppulo, to support University departments in creating, managing, and sharing engaging content across campus. The platform supports a wide variety of media formats including videos, websites, PowerPoint videos, interactive maps, RSS feeds, live data streams, PDFs, and more giving content administrators the flexibility to tailor messaging to their audiences.
With centralized control, departments can manage signage across multiple buildings from a single interface. The system also encourages collaboration by allowing departments to share and display content on each other’s signs, enhancing communication and visibility throughout the University.
In the event of a campus emergency, Pitt Police can broadcast alerts instantly across all enterprise digital signs to ensure rapid and widespread notification.
To help departments deploy effective signage, Pitt Digital provides consulting services to identify the most suitable hardware solutions, along with training for staff who will manage their department’s signage systems.

Benefits
Pitt Digital’s signage platform offers a range of features to help departments manage and enhance their digital displays across campus:
- Flexible Content Control: Upload, schedule, and manage various media types with ease.
- Wayfinding Support: Interactive signs can be configured for wayfinding, though this requires additional setup beyond simple image deployment.
- Remote Monitoring: View previews of your signs and restart players on a schedule for basic maintenance and troubleshooting.
- Efficient Scheduling: Copy recurrence settings between items to save time.
- Synchronized Playback: Play video content simultaneously across multiple displays.
- Live Data Display: Enable smooth scrolling of real-time data on interactive signs.

Cost
The cost of Enterprise Digital Signage depends on how many content players you plan to use. A content player is the machine used to drive the display of your signs. There is a recurring annual maintenance cost of $250 per content player. This license fee is due at the time of implementation and renewable annually on April 1.
